Understanding Zero-Trust IAM

Zero-Trust is not a single software product but a comprehensive security framework built on a simple, uncompromising principle: never trust, always verify. Under this model, no user or device is trusted by default, whether they are inside or outside the organization's physical network. Every access request must be explicitly authenticated, authorized, and continuously validated.

Identity and Access Management (IAM) serves as the engine of this framework. By aligning your IAM strategy with the strict guidelines established by global standards bodies like the National Institute of Standards and Technology (NIST), enterprises can ensure that only the right people have the right access to the right resources at the right time.

Why Traditional Security Fails

Historically, once a user successfully logged into a corporate VPN or bypassed an external firewall, they were granted broad lateral access to the internal network. If a hacker managed to phish a single employee's password, they could freely roam the network, locate sensitive databases, and exfiltrate proprietary data. Zero-Trust mitigates this risk through micro-segmentation and the principle of least privilege (PoLP), ensuring that a single compromised credential does not lead to a catastrophic, organization-wide breach.

Key Pillars of a Successful Zero-Trust IAM Strategy

To successfully deploy Zero-Trust within your organization, you must focus on three core pillars:

  1. Continuous Authentication: Continuously monitor user behavior, device health, and contextual signals (like location and time of access) to verify identity dynamically.
  2. Least Privilege Access: Limit user access rights to only what is strictly necessary to complete their immediate tasks.

What is Zero-Trust security?

Zero-Trust is a cybersecurity framework that assumes threats are present everywhere. It requires continuous verification of every user, device, and transaction, rather than trusting users automatically based on their location inside a corporate network.
